Price: $699 PROS: Everything!! The biggest benefit is the ability to fit larger tires, which in turn provides more clearance at the diffs. With the tires and lift, going from 31's to 33's, the frame and T-case gain about 5 inches of clearance. The install was easy, it took about 6-7 hours at a leisurely(sp.?) pace, with two of us, and every air tool you could imagine. It was much easier to install than the salemen want you to believe. CONS: Ride is slightly worse, only on rough roads though. In town, you don't really notice. Cornering is not as good as before, but still better than my mom's stock tahoe and my friend's stock 2wd Chevy. If I had a 22r I would highly recomend gears, but with the V6 and 33's I can still use 5th gear, and the mileage is actually better. BOTTOM LINE: Buy It!! I love it, even though it doesn't actually increase travel, it has enough travel for all of my offroad uses.
